Wheel bearing installed wrong

Well I needed to replace the front wheel bearing. I did this and the abs traction lights were on. I knew something was wrong and read up on it and realized the wheel bearing has the abs sensor ring in it.

For my civic the axle has the abs ring on it so I was a bit confused at first.

I took it apart thinking I can press it out but I dont think I can without ruining the bearing. Is there a way to press the bearing out without ruining it. The knuckle covers the outer race.
